1. Embrace Physical Activity:
One of the best ways to manage stress is through physical activity. Aries individuals have a surplus of energy, and channeling it into exercise can provide a much-needed release. Engaging in activities such as hiking, kickboxing, or even dancing can help you release tension, clear your mind, and promote a sense of wellbeing. Regular exercise not only reduces stress levels but also boosts your overall mood and vitality.

One of the first steps in managing stress as an Aries is to recognize the signs of stress. Aries individuals tend to push themselves to the limit, often neglecting their own needs in the process. It is essential to pay attention to physical and emotional cues such as fatigue, irritability, and difficulty concentrating. By acknowledging these signs, you can take proactive steps to address your stress levels before they escalate.
One effective tool for managing stress as an Aries is to prioritize self-care. While it may seem counterintuitive to slow down and take time for yourself, it is crucial for your overall well-being. Engage in activities that bring you joy and relaxation, such as exercise, meditation, or spending time in nature. Aries individuals thrive on physical activity, so finding an outlet to release pent-up energy can be highly beneficial. Whether it’s going for a run, taking a yoga class, or engaging in a competitive sport, find what works best for you and make it a priority in your daily routine.
